Location: Situated in the Kreuzberg district of Berlin, Germany, Markthalle Neun is a historic market hall that has been revitalized into a vibrant street food destination.

Why it's a great detour: Markthalle Neun offers an authentic taste of Berlin's dynamic culinary scene within a beautifully restored 19th-century market hall. Visitors can explore a diverse range of local and international street foods, artisanal products, and seasonal events that celebrate food culture, making it an engaging stop for all ages and interests.
Key activities: Sample a variety of street food from local vendors, attend themed food events like the popular Street Food Thursday, shop for fresh and artisanal groceries, and enjoy live music or cooking demonstrations. The market also hosts workshops and special events that highlight sustainable and traditional food practices.
Kid-friendly focus: The lively atmosphere and variety of food options make it enjoyable for families with young children. There are many casual seating areas and kid-friendly food choices, making it easy to accommodate little ones.
Dog-friendly notes: Dogs are welcome in the market area, especially during outdoor events, but it's advisable to keep pets on a leash and be mindful of busy times. Some vendors may have restrictions, so checking ahead is recommended.
